Who knew that crt own a property development company in partnership with a company called bloc developments. The company is called H2O urban. On one of its developments in salford Manchester they are refusing to restore the canal that runs through the site? Whereβs the oversight of this activity by crt, letβs not forget itβs public money and assets we are talking about. Where is all of this mentioned in crts published accounts. The whole thing stinks of corruption and brown envelopes. We need some oversight of their activities, boaters should be demanding it. Post by β on Aug 6, 2023 16:38:55 GMT
More like to others.
The Norwood top lock example was interesting. Sold to a developer. This was BW/CRT land.
The question is was it sold for the correct value and who valued it.
Building land in Southall with room for 10 substantial houses sold got the CRT Β£1.5m in 2013. Too cheap?

Post by β on Aug 6, 2023 18:51:43 GMT
They might just say it is commercially sensitive information.
Another site below Norwood top locks was sold for Β£2,775,000+ vat according to land registry. This looked to be an ex BW depot as I remember seeing boats stored there. Now has about 40 canalside flats no doubt Β£500k each.
